GENERAL SUMMARY:

The Nurse Manager - Float (NM-F) will be temporarily assigned to hospital departments with Nurse Manager vacancies. The NM-F will serve as the assigned department's Interim Nurse Manager for the duration of the assignment. Under administrative direction of both the BestChoice Nursing Director as well as the Director/Nursing Administrator of the unit, the NM-F will assume administrative accountability for leading, managing, developing, supervising and evaluating all aspects of patient care. The NM-F will manage and collaborate relationships with leadership members, physicians and care of the responsible patient populations. The NM-F will assure professional, clinical and educational excellence in the provision of quality care to patients. The NM-F will facilitate empowerment of staff in the implementation of creative and innovative patient care delivery models and stimulate a collaborative multidisciplinary team approach in the continuous improvement of patient care services. The NM-F will assume responsibility for fiscal management of the unit.

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:



  • Bachelor of Science Degree in Nursing or completion of other formal nursing education necessary to obtain /maintain and advanced practice nursing Michigan license (midwife, CRNA, CNS or Nurse Practitioner)
    Master's degree in Nursing, Business, Health Management or another related field preferred.
  • ANCC recognized nursing specialty certification preferred.
  • Minimum of 2 years of clinical experience in an acute care setting.
  • Minimum of 2 years Nurse Manager experience.
  • Knowledge of quality management and service excellence.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ong interpersonal skills that provide coaching and facilitation expertise.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ills.
  • Demonstrates innovative, creative leadership style.
  • Demonstrated project management experience.



CERTIFICATIONS/LICENSURES REQUIRED:



  • Current licensure to practice in the State of Michigan as a Registered Nurse.
  • BLS certification required, ACLS certification recommended.
